Let\u2019s explore essential strategies to secure your financial future while embracing the Spanish lifestyle you\u2019ve dreamed of.<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><b>Understanding the Cost of Living in Spain<\/b><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Living expenses in Spain vary greatly from one region to another, making location a crucial factor in financial planning. Here\u2019s a detailed breakdown of costs across major cities:<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>1. Barcelona<\/b><\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Average monthly rent (1-bedroom apartment): \u20ac900-1,200<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Utilities: \u20ac120-150<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Public transport pass: \u20ac40<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Dining out: \u20ac15-25 per meal<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><b>2. Madrid<\/b><\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Average monthly rent (1-bedroom apartment): \u20ac850-1,100<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Utilities: \u20ac100-130<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Public transport pass: \u20ac54.60<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Dining out: \u20ac12-20 per meal<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><b>3. Valencia<\/b><\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Average monthly rent (1-bedroom apartment): \u20ac600-800<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Utilities: \u20ac90-120<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Public transport pass: \u20ac35<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Dining out: \u20ac10-18 per meal<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Smaller towns and rural areas offer significantly lower costs, with monthly expenses often 30-40% below major city rates. A comfortable lifestyle in these areas typically requires \u20ac1,500-2,000 monthly, compared to \u20ac2,500-3,000 in larger cities.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Key Local Expenses to Consider:<\/b><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Housing deposits (typically 2-3 months rent)<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Community fees in apartment buildings<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Home insurance requirements<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Regional tax variations<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Local market vs. supermarket pricing<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Zone-specific parking fees<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Area-dependent entertainment costs<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">These cost variations highlight the importance of researching specific neighborhoods and understanding local pricing structures before settling in any Spanish region. Your choice of location directly impacts your required monthly budget and potential savings capacity.<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><b>Creating a Comprehensive Budget<\/b><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Creating a detailed budget is essential for expat life in Spain. Madrid\u2019s commercial real estate sector attracts international investors seeking stable returns in the Spanish capital.<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><b>Navigating the Spanish Tax System<\/b><\/h2>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.uniplaces.com\/city-explorer\/navigating-the-spain-tax-system-tips-for-expats-in-barcelona-madrid-and-valencia\/\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Tax considerations<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> for expats in Spain require careful attention to both local and international regulations. The Spanish tax system operates on a progressive scale, with rates varying based on income levels and residency status.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Key Tax Elements for Expats:<\/b><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Personal Income Tax (IRPF): Rates range from 19% to 47%<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Wealth Tax: Applicable to worldwide assets above \u20ac700,000<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Capital Gains Tax: Ranging from 19% to 26%<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Property Tax: Annual tax based on cadastral value<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p><b>Tax Residency Status<\/b><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">You\u2019re considered a tax resident in Spain if you:<\/span><\/p>\n<ol>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Stay in Spain for more than 183 days per year<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Have your main economic interests in Spain<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Live with a spouse or dependent children who are Spanish residents<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ol>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Tax residents must declare worldwide income, while non-residents only pay taxes on Spanish-sourced income.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Double Taxation Treaties<\/b><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Spain maintains tax agreements with numerous countries to prevent double taxation. These treaties determine:<\/span><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Which country has primary taxing rights<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Available tax credits and exemptions<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Specific rules for different types of income<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Understanding these agreements helps optimize your tax position and ensures compliance with both Spanish and home country regulations. Working with a tax advisor who specializes in expat retirement planning can help navigate complex cross-border tax situations and maximize available benefits under applicable treaties.<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><b>Understanding Healthcare Options in Spain<\/b><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Spain\u2019s healthcare system ranks among Europe\u2019s finest, offering expats comprehensive medical coverage through both public and private channels.
